COSO - CoastalSouth Bancshares, Inc.
CoastalSouth Bancshares, Inc. operates as the bank holding company of CoastalStates Bank that provides various banking products and services to retail and commercial customers. The company accepts various deposits, such as checking, savings and money market, certificates of deposit, and individual retirement accounts.
